For a short period of time, Target is carrying a brand of cookie that almost fully defines my college experience. They are called Tim Tams, and are sold only in Australia. My friend Nicole, who is half Aussie, introduced these cookies to me freshman year of college. Together with my cocoamotion, we enjoyed Tim Tam Slams, which are only the most delicious way to enjoy these cookies. A new friendship and a new obsession were born simultaneously. Because we are not able to buy these cookies in the states, we had to come up with alternative cookies to try Slams with (chocolate covered Oreos and Keebler Grasshoppers work well). However, Target has made these little beauties available for a LIMITED time. I think until March. I have bought 3 boxes already, and am fighting the urge to buy more.Please, visit the cookie aisle at Target and try these for yourselves (they are packaged in a white Pepperidge Farms package, not the original brown Arnott’s kind)
